Home Demolition Service in Houston, TX
Home demolition services involve the careful removal of entire structures or specific parts of residential properties, such as garages, sheds, or additions. These projects typically include tearing down outdated or damaged buildings, clearing space for new construction, or removing structures that are no longer safe or functional. Property owners interested in this service should understand the scope of demolition work, including site preparation, debris removal, and adherence to local regulations, to ensure the project proceeds smoothly and efficiently.
Before requesting home demolition services, property owners usually want to clarify the extent of the work, whether it involves complete building removal or partial demolition, and what preparations are necessary beforehand. It’s also important to consider any permits or approvals required by local authorities, as well as how the site will be cleared and prepared for future use. Understanding these details can help ensure the demolition process aligns with the property owner’s plans and complies with all relevant guidelines.

Common Home Demolition Service Jobs
Residential home demolition - complete removal of entire houses for rebuilding or renovation projects.
Garage and shed demolition - safe teardown of detached structures to create space or update property layouts.
Interior demolition - removal of interior walls, flooring, or fixtures to prepare for remodeling.
Selective demolition - targeted removal of specific sections or features within a property.
Foundation demolition - tearing down old or damaged foundations to facilitate new construction.
Commercial building demolition - dismantling of larger structures for redevelopment or site clearance.
Home Demolition Service Questions
What types of structures can be demolished? Home demolition services typically cover houses, garages, sheds, and other residential structures.
How should I prepare my property for demolition? Clearing the area around the structure and removing valuable items helps facilitate a smooth demolition process.
Are there permits required for home demolition? Local regulations often require permits, and contacting the appropriate authorities ensures compliance before starting.
What is the purpose of a demolition permit? A permit ensures the demolition follows safety standards and local codes, preventing legal issues.
